What is a B2B Order Management System?

A B2B Order Management System is an online platform designed to help businesses manage their sales orders, products, and payments swiftly. It’s also different from the old-school way of doing things as it automatically accomplishes tasks and integrates orders across a variety of channels.
It integrates with B2B CRM software, Point-of-Sale systems, and e-commerce platforms. With B2B sales order management software, businesses reduce errors, save time, and gain visibility at every step of the order process.

What to Consider Before Choosing B2B Order Management Software?

Selecting the best order management system software is a tactical decision that can impact productivity and customer satisfaction. There are technology, ease of use, and integration considerations companies need to bear in mind before taking the plunge.

1. Business Needs & Scale Then there are businesses-to-business companies that need order management for wholesalers and stockists; startups building simple order management software for small businesses; and companies delivering complex solutions such as AI forecasting for enterprises. Selecting b2b software for your scale offers a cost-benefit.

2. Integration Capabilities Your order management system needs to integrate with your current CRM, ERP, and POS. The tight coupling leads to fewer Units and higher data accuracy. This helps provide a consistent customer experience across channels.

3. Customization & Flexibility Every industry has unique workflows. B2B Order Management Software you can customize to add features, automate approvals, or integrate with niche tools. It is crucial that the system can scale with your business.

4. User Experience & Training A clunky interface hinders adoption, and it frustrates staff. An intuitive interface means staff will be up and running in no time. Improved usability lowers training costs and resistance to change.

5. Cost & Maintenance Don’t forget that both license fees and support will apply. It is possible that cloud-based options have lower setup costs but require monthly subscriptions. With budgeting, nothing is hidden, and there are no surprises.

Custom OMS vs. Ready-Made Solutions

Businesses can choose between custom B2B order management software and ready-made solutions. Each has its strengths depending on size, complexity, and budget.

1. Custom Order Management System Customized systems are created for unique work processes and business requirements. They cost more, but they eventually pay off as well and can help in the war for talent.

2. Ready-Made Solutions There's a lot to be said for a quick rollout with low-merit capital. Solutions like Zoho and NetSuite offer core modules for small- to midsize companies. But it is not very customizable, and scaling might have to move elsewhere.
